"North Korea Escalates Tensions with Over 200 Artillery Rounds Fired Near South's Border"

TL;DR Summary
North Korea fired 200 artillery shells into waters near its western sea border with South Korea, escalating tensions but causing no damage as the shells fell north of the border. South Korea responded with its own artillery fire and took precautionary measures, including evacuating residents from border islands. This aggressive military action by North Korea breaks a 2018 agreement to halt live-fire drills near the border, raising concerns about regional peace and stability.
